Walter KINGSMAN

Extended Description
Captain Walter KINGSMAN. Royal Defence Corps.
Died 9 October 1922 aged 53

Husband of Annie Louisa Kingsman.

Wills and Admin, Ancestry. He resided at 47 Belle Vue Road Shrewsbury, political agent, died 9 October 1922 at Quarry House Nursing Home Shrewsbury. His effects went to his widow Annie Louisa.

London Gazette dated 5 February 1915
TERRITORIAL FORCE RESERVE. General List.
The undermentioned to be Lieutenants
Walter Kingsman (late Corporal, London Irish Rifles). Dated 21st January, 1915 and others.

At rest at Shrewsbury Cemetery, Shropshire.

Also commemorated on this headstone is his son -

Second Lieutenant Roland Walter KINGSMAN 10th Bn. Machine Gun Corps (Infantry)
Died 12 October 1917 aged 21
Son of A L Kingsman, 47 Belle Vue Road, Shrewsbury and the late Capt. Walter Kingsman.
At rest at Bedford House Cemetery, Belgium.
